Swimming Betting Strategy for MCWApp Players

Swimming is one of those sports where doing a bit of homework before placing your bet on mcwapp genuinely pays off. Unlike football, where a single moment of brilliance from a substitute can completely change the result, swimming outcomes are more closely tied to form, fitness, and race conditions. That means the research you put in before an event has a more direct relationship with the quality of your bet.

The first thing worth understanding is the difference between heats and finals. Many top swimmers deliberately hold back in heats to conserve energy for the final. If you're betting on heat outcomes on mcwapp, the favourite doesn't always swim their fastest — which creates value on swimmers who are known to race hard in heats. Conversely, in finals, the favourites tend to perform closer to their peak, which makes race winner markets more predictable but also tighter on odds.

Head-to-head markets on mcwapp are particularly interesting for swimming because they remove the complexity of a full field and reduce the bet to a simple binary outcome. If you follow the sport closely and know that Swimmer A consistently beats Swimmer B in 200m butterfly despite similar world rankings, that knowledge has real value in a head-to-head market where the odds might not fully reflect that historical pattern.

The relay markets deserve special attention. Relay teams are more volatile than individual events because a single swimmer having a bad day can cost the entire team a medal. On mcwapp, relay odds tend to be more generous than individual event odds for the same reason — the bookmakers are pricing in that uncertainty. If you have strong knowledge of a particular national team's current roster and form, relay markets can offer excellent value.

Live betting on mcwapp during swimming events is a different skill entirely. Races are short — a 100m freestyle final is over in under 50 seconds — so live betting windows are narrow. The 200m and 400m events give you more time to react. If a strong favourite gets a poor start or is clearly struggling at the turn, the live odds on mcwapp will shift quickly, and that's when experienced bettors look for value on the swimmer who's leading at the halfway mark.

One practical tip for mcwapp players in Bangladesh: check the event schedule before a major swimming tournament and identify the two or three races where you have the most knowledge. Spreading your bankroll across every race is rarely a good strategy. Concentrating on the events you understand best and using the rest of the card as entertainment viewing tends to produce better results over time.
